We love what NYC Dept. of Transportation has been doing to create pedestrian plazas with local communities. On Saturday, we went to back to one of our favorites – Corona Plaza under the 7 train, in Queens. This was our 6th time setting up in this newly pedestrianized space, and again our host was the Queens Museum of Art. QMA staff brought their own activities geared towards families and children, and joined us to lead read-alouds using some of our new books.

Thanks to QMA staff member Alexandra Maria Garcia, for inviting us and coordinating read-alouds, and to Uni volunteers Leigh, Stephanie, and Will. Thanks also to Uni installer Nelson, and Amelia, who is working with us for the summer from MIT. Great day in Corona!
